Why You Should Hire an Asbestos Attorney
An experienced asbestos lawyer can help you pursue a claim against at-fault individuals responsible for your exposure. They can also guide you through a settlement or lawsuit to get the best outcome.
Asbestos exposure is the cause of lung cancer and mesothelioma in high-risk occupations, like construction workers. Shipyard workers and Navy sailors are also at risk. A New York asbestos attorney can simplify the legal process and increase your chances of obtaining compensation for your losses.

The state laws that you know about
A good asbestos lawyer must be knowledgeable of all laws that pertain to asbestos in the state you live in. This knowledge can assist you in filing a lawsuit against asbestos distributors, manufacturers, and employers who exposed to you to this harmful mineral. They can also assist in filing claims using asbestos trust funds established by bankrupt companies responsible for asbestos contamination.
A lawyer with a proven track record of winning mesothelioma cases are a must. This includes recent wins, huge settlement amounts and verdicts won in trials. In addition, a good New York asbestos attorney should offer a contingency-based payment plan. This means you only pay only if they win your case.
In the initial consultation, you should bring any documents that could be related to your exposure or illness. These could include medical records, such as chest x-rays and test results. Your attorney will review the information to determine if you are entitled to compensation.
They can also help you with filing an asbestos lawsuit against the responsible parties, which may include asbestos product manufacturers as well as asbestos insurance companies and construction companies that have wrongly handled asbestos-containing products. They can help you determine the defendants you need to include in your lawsuit and explain how the law impacts your potential to receive a fair injury settlement.
In a lot of cases it is necessary for your asbestos attorney to engage experts to establish that your condition was caused by exposure to asbestos. Experts will write reports or testify in depositions and in trials. They can prove causation, which is important in obtaining an equitable settlement.
Asbestos litigation is governed by a broad range of statutes and rules that vary by state. Some of these include the minimum medical requirements, regulations governing two diseases, expedited scheduling and joinders. New York is among the states that have passed asbestos legislation. For example the James L. Zadroga 9/11 Health & Compensation Act helped first responders suffering health conditions because of their work at the World Trade Center following the attacks.
Expertise in Asbestos cases
Asbestos is a mineral that is fibrous that is used for its durability, flexibility and resistance to chemicals and heat. It was widely used in industrial and commercial applications throughout the 20th century, which included insulation for pipes and fireproofing materials, as well as plasters and cements, and brakes for cars. However, exposure to asbestos can result in serious ailments and injuries, like mesothelioma, among other types of lung cancer. Victims and their families may be entitled to compensation from asbestos companies who have deliberately exposed people to this hazardous substance.
Asbestos lawyers can help victims receive the maximum compensation they can through a lawsuit or trust fund claim. An attorney who has experience in asbestos litigation can explain the laws of the state, negotiate with defendants, and bring the case to trial if needed. Mesothelioma attorneys can also recognize unfair tactics employed by a business and defend their clients' rights.
National firms that focus on mesothelioma cases know the way that state and local courts handle these kinds of cases. They can file a lawsuit in the state where it is most likely to yield the best possible outcome for their client. New York, for example is a well-known place for plaintiffs to bring asbestos lawsuits due to the high level of asbestos exposure. Ability to negotiate
A lawyer who is knowledgeable in asbestos litigation will be able to bargain with the companies involved in your case. This is crucial because many victims don't want go to trial. They prefer to settle their claims. They are able to avoid the stress and expense of a court trial and receive their compensation earlier than they would have otherwise. Trials are open to the public, which is why it helps them maintain their privacy. It is possible that the companies involved in a case might also wish to avoid their name being linked to a case as it could hurt their reputation.
In order to get fair compensation in an asbestos claim requires lots of research and information gathering. Your lawyer will review your medical records, your employment history (if you served in the military) and receipts, bills and other evidence to create a convincing argument for your injuries. It can be a long procedure and your lawyer will be right by your side throughout the process.
After obtaining the required information the lawyer will file a lawsuit on your behalf. Then they will determine who is accountable for your injuries. They can include former employers, property owners, and the manufacturers of asbestos-related products or equipment. Your lawyer will also look into potential asbestos trust funds you could be able to claim.
The discovery process plays an important role in your settlement negotiations. During the discovery process your lawyer will seek documents from defendants involved in your case. They will also conduct depositions that are sworn statements that can be used in your trial. Your lawyer will prepare the deposition ahead of time and will be with you throughout the process.
You could be entitled compensation. If you succeed in settling your case, you can apply the money to pay for medical expenses as well as emotional stress and loss of quality of life. If you are litigating on behalf of a loved one, the money can be used to pay for funeral and burial costs.
